On the 20th of October Barnes and Noble introduced the “nook” eBook reader to the US market. No doubt this move was designed to compete with the success of the Amazon Kindle which until now has not been available to Australian customers. Tough New Motion F5 and C5 with Gorilla Glass Officially Launched
The Motion F5 and Motion C5 Tablet PCs are now officially tougher! Motion Computing has officially launched the new C5 MCA and F5 Field Tablet PC with Corning Gorilla Glass – 4 times stronger than regular display glass.
